The Division of Transportation (DOT) conducts numerous levels of inspections, ranging from standard paperwork checks to whole-blown auto assessments. These inspections are performed by Qualified safety inspectors and are sometimes unannounced, so it's essential to stay ready continually. The most typical is the Level I inspection, a 37-phase course of action that features an intensive examination of the driving force’s credentials as well as the motor vehicle by itself. Inspectors examine every little thing from your brakes and tires to lights, steering mechanisms, plus more. They’ll also evaluate logbooks, medical playing cards, and licenses to guarantee anything is latest and precise.

An enormous Portion of passing a DOT inspection is reliable upkeep. Diesel vehicles are workhorses, but they also endure lots of put on and tear. Easy things like worn-out brake pads or malfunctioning lights may result in failed inspections. Buying standard upkeep not just keeps your truck in major form but also minimizes the potential risk of remaining flagged through an inspection. Retaining comprehensive documents of the routine maintenance and repair service history is Similarly important. Technological innovation is progressively playing a job in DOT inspections at the same time. Lots of vans now use electronic logging equipment (ELDs), which ensure it is easier to retain correct documents of hrs of services (HOS). When these equipment simplify compliance, In addition they indicate inspectors can rapidly obtain your information — so precision is more significant than ever.
